Menopause Belly: Why It Happens & How to Beat It
Struggling with stubborn belly fat in midlife? You’re not alone. As women enter perimenopause and menopause, hormonal changes, slowed metabolism, and increased insulin resistance make it easier to gain weight—especially around the abdomen. Traditional diets and excessive cardio often backfire, but a smart menopause nutrition plan can help.
Key factors driving menopause belly:
Hormonal shifts: Lower estrogen leads to increased fat storage around the waist.
Metabolism decline: Muscle loss slows calorie burn, making weight gain more likely.
Blood sugar imbalances: Insulin resistance promotes fat storage.
Chronic stress & cortisol: Stress increases belly fat and cravings.
How to beat menopause belly naturally:
Prioritise protein & healthy fats for better metabolism and hormone balance.
Manage stress with mindfulness and restorative movement.
Incorporate strength training to rebuild muscle and boost metabolism.
Support gut health with fibre-rich foods.
Avoid processed foods, sugar, and alcohol that disrupt hormones.

Energy: Please Return to Sender! How to Reclaim Your Energy and Vitality during Perimenopause and Menopause.
If you're over 40 and struggling with low energy, you're not alone. Fatigue is one of the most common symptoms of perimenopause and menopause, driven by hormonal changes, poor sleep, stress, and blood sugar imbalances.
In this article, we explore why menopause zaps your energy—from declining oestrogen and progesterone to slowing metabolism, mood shifts, and stress overload. We also cover practical, science-backed strategies to boost energy naturally, including:
Balanced Nutrition: Prioritise protein, healthy fats, and fibre-rich foods for steady energy.
Better Sleep: Manage night sweats, support melatonin production, and establish a sleep-friendly routine.
Stress Management: Reduce cortisol levels through relaxation techniques and lifestyle adjustments.
Exercise & Hydration: Keep your body active and hydrated to support metabolism and energy production.
Plus, we highlight other factors that could be draining your energy, such as thyroid dysfunction, nutrient deficiencies, and sleep apnea.
